If this is the 4th floor pictured, then the reactor containment and core are below. There was no fuel in the unit 4 reactor core - it was off line for maintenance and evaluation. The spent fuel pool is, I think, on this floor. They generally onload and offload fuel into the reactor from the top through a large access "lid". The crane removes the fuel, and then sets it down into the spent fuel pool on the same floor. Pretty efficient design providing a 45 foot tsunami doesn't wipe out all of your power supplies.
I could be mistaken - the refueling floor should have large crane rails, and less equipment. This might be a floor below the refueling floor. Which means that it's adjacent to the reactor containment structure, not above it.
